  • Polycationic supports for nucleic acid purification, separation and hybridization
    申请人:GEN-PROBE INCORPORATED
    公开号:EP0281390A2
    公开(公告)日:1988-09-07
    Described herein is the use of polycationic solid supports in the purification of nucleic acids from solutions containing contaminants. The nucleic acids non-covalently bind to the support without signficant binding of contaminants permitting their separation from the contaminants. The bound nucleic acids can be recovered from the support. Also described is the use of the supports as a means to separate polynucleotides and hybrids thereof with a nucleotide probe from unhybridized probe. Assays for target nucleotide sequences are described which employ this separation procedure.
